Aaron Brink, a seasoned mixed martial artist, competed with a record of 26 wins, 26 losses, and no draws (2 NC) in his career. He primarily fought in the heavyweight division, weighing 205 lbs. Standing at 6'3", Brink demonstrated an orthodox stance in the ring. In terms of performance statistics during his UFC career, Brink averaged 3.49 significant strikes per minute and maintained a striking accuracy of 42%. However, he absorbed a considerable number of strikes with 5.71 strikes being landed against him every minute. His strike defense was commendable at 57%, indicating his ability to evade a substantial portion of incoming attacks. Brink did not attempt any takedowns or submissions during his UFC career, focusing primarily on striking. Aaron Brink's career highlights include a notable loss against Andrei Arlovski in 2000 via armbar submission. This marked the end of his UFC career, as he did not compete in any fights after this date.
